dc.description.abstractThe main purpose of this project is to study the perceptions, attitudes, and habits of academic librarians in Italy in relation to the spread of the Internet and the World Wide Web within their working life. In particular, the aim is to find out how the Internet has entered every side of the librarian profession, and which are the possible consequences on the workloads. The attention will be also put on librarians' keenness of networked technologies.it
